DRS Pivotal Power, Inc. is located in Bedford, Nova Scotia. DRS Pivotal Power is a leader in the design, development, and manufacture of high-reliability power conversion equipment for mission-critical applications supporting all branches of the military in Canada, the US, and internationally. All products are designed and manufactured in-house by our team of over 100 employees. DRS Pivotal Power is part of the Leonardo DRS Naval Electronics group and has over 30,000 fielded units with a field reliability of over 99%.
